Jadeja Hails RSS For Nation-building, Extends Warm Wishes On Its Centenary Year
Prime Minister Narendra Bhai Modi: India's senior all-rounder Ravindra Jadeja shared his thoughts on the centenary year of the Rashtriya Swayamsevak Sangh (RSS), the world's largest voluntary organisation, and credited RSS shakhas for nurturing personalities to play a vital role in nation-building, citing Prime Minister Narendra Modi as the prime example.
Founded in 1925 by Keshav Baliram Hedgewar, the RSS turned 100 on the auspicious occasion of Vijayadashami on October 2. It was established as a volunteer-based organisation to foster cultural awareness, discipline, service, and social responsibility among citizens.
"My experiences and thoughts on the occasion of the centenary year of the Rashtriya Swayamsevak Sangh (RSS), the world's largest voluntary organization. Before independence, the exploitation of the nation's soul and core culture by the British and various ideologies, and the concern about the dire consequences if the culture were destroyed, led to the birth of the Rashtriya Swayamsevak Sangh. 2nd Test: Rahul Hits Unbeaten 58 As India Beat WI By Seven-wicket To Sweep Series 2-0
India needed exactly an hour on day five to complete a seven-wicket win over West Indies and seal a 2-0 series sweep at the Arun Jaitley Stadium on Tuesday. KL Rahul anchored the chase with an unbeaten 58 off 108 balls, hitting six fours and two sixes to help India easily hunt down 121.
